Assemble or modify electromechanical equipment or devices, such as servomechanisms, gyros, dynamometers, magnetic drums, tape drives, brakes, control linkage, actuators, and appliances. |

- Inspect, test, and adjust completed units to ensure that units meet specifications, tolerances, and customer order requirements.
- Assemble parts or units, and position, align, and fasten units to assemblies, subassemblies, or frames, using hand tools and power tools.
- Position, align, and adjust parts for proper fit and assembly.
- Connect cables, tubes, and wiring, according to specifications.
- Attach name plates and mark identifying information on parts.
- Read blueprints and specifications to determine component parts and assembly sequences of electromechanical units.
- Disassemble units to replace parts or to crate them for shipping.
